No - you cannot reopen the application. You have to apply again.

The travel history refusal reason means that your father has been refused because he does not have a travel history. CIC prefers applicants to have travel history - preferably to other countries that requires visas (e.g. UK, US, Europe).

Six months is too long a visit for someone with no travel history. He also hasn't show sufficient funds for this long a stay. If you want to reapply - as for a 2 to 3 week visit.

You can apply again immediately if you want to. Even if you can show more funds - you should still keep the trip to 2-3 weeks. A six month visit is too long and shows your father has effectively no ties to his home country.
